Paul G. Abel
Frequent passing cloud was a nuisance but seeing was fair for a while as the sun was low in the sky.
Illuminated Disk: Some markings seen- these look like the ends of the usual bands seen when the phase is larger.
Bright Limb Band: Visible and complete
Terminator:  Geometrically regular
Cusp Caps: Interestingly,the southern cusp cap seemed to be duller than the northern cusp cap.  The effect was slightly more prominent in the W15 yellow filter.
Cusp Collars:  Perhaps the edges of the collars are becoming visible?
By 0958UT the seeing started to fall off as the sun was higher in the sky and so Venus observations were concluded.

[Paul G. Abel:Leicester:United Kingdom]

Antonio Cidadao
I had a period of good transparency and average seeing on Sept 17,and obtained two independent 20min SERs. A completely different gain setting was used to avoid oversaturation of the dayside (the 10-150 gain setting previously used was not adequate anymore). Specifically (for my Neptune-C II camera,a 14" SCT working at f/5,and the Pixelteq 1010nm/38nm filter,stacked with a Baader Sloan Y' filter),both SERs were captured at 100ms exposure but with gain set to ZERO. I used my normal processing.
The attached image shows the individual processing of the two SERs and,at the right,the result of stacking them. The brighter linear feature is arrowed,and a winjupos simulation map is also included. A gif animation from both SErs and stack is attached.
I really hope that better seeing conditions will be available in a 4-day period (i.e. on Sept 21) to evaluate a possible feature return. Can this be a NS view of the Cloud Discontinuity?
